Kuinka työntää ja seurata uutta Git-haaraa

Git Command Line

Alkaen Gitin Branchesista

Haarojen luominen ja hallinta Gitissä on välttämätöntä virtaviivaistetuille kehitystyönkuluille. Tämä opas näyttää, kuinka voit luoda uuden paikallisen haaran toisesta haarasta ja siirtää sen etävarastoon.

Varmistamme myös, että haara on jäljitettävissä, jotta voit helposti käyttää git pull ja git push komentoja. Seuraamalla näitä ohjeita parannat versionhallintakäytäntöjäsi ja yhteistyön tehokkuutta.

Komento Kuvaus
git checkout -b Luo uuden haaran ja vaihtaa siihen välittömästi.
git push -u Työntää haaran etävarastoon ja määrittää seurannan.
git branch -vv Luetteloi kaikki paikalliset konttorit ja niiden seurantatiedot.
#!/bin/bash Osoittaa, että komentosarja tulee suorittaa Bash-kuoren avulla.
if [ -z "$1" ]; then Tarkistaa, onko parametri välitetty komentosarjalle, mikä osoittaa, onko haaran nimi annettu.
exit 1 Poistuu komentosarjasta virhetilalla, jos haaran nimeä ei ole annettu.

Käsikirjoituksen työnkulun ymmärtäminen

Toimitetut komentosarjat auttavat automatisoimaan uuden haaran luomisen ja työntämisen Gitissä. Ensimmäinen komentosarja sisältää manuaalisen käytön -komento luodaksesi uuden haaran nykyisestä haarasta ja sen jälkeen komento työntämään uusi haara etävarastoon ja määrittämään sen seurantaa varten. Tämä varmistaa tulevaisuuden ja git push komennot toimivat saumattomasti. The komento varmistaa, että haara seuraa etähaaraa oikein.

Toinen komentosarja on Bash-skripti, joka automatisoi nämä vaiheet. Se tarkistaa ensin, onko haaran nimi annettu käyttämällä . Jos haaran nimeä ei anneta, se poistuu virhetilalla käyttämällä . Jos haaran nimi annetaan, se luo haaran, jossa on ja työntää sen kaukosäätimeen git push -u. Lopuksi se vahvistaa haaran seurannan -painikkeella . Tämä automaatio yksinkertaistaa työnkulkua ja varmistaa johdonmukaisuuden toimipisteen hallinnassa.

Uuden Git-haaran luominen ja työntäminen

Gitin komentoriviohjeet

# Step 1: Create a new branch from the current branch
git checkout -b new-branch-name

# Step 2: Push the new branch to the remote repository
git push -u origin new-branch-name

# Step 3: Verify that the branch is tracking the remote branch
git branch -vv

# Step 4: Now you can use 'git pull' and 'git push' for this branch
git pull
git push

Haarojen luomisen ja Gitin työnnän automatisointi

Bash Script automaatiota varten

#!/bin/bash
# Usage: ./create_push_branch.sh new-branch-name

# Step 1: Check if branch name is provided
if [ -z "$1" ]; then
  echo "No branch name provided"
  exit 1
fi

# Step 2: Create a new branch
git checkout -b $1

# Step 3: Push the new branch to the remote repository and track it
git push -u origin $1

# Step 4: Confirm branch tracking
git branch -vv

Sivukonttorin hallinnan tehostaminen Gitissä

Toinen tärkeä näkökohta Git-haarojen kanssa työskentelyssä on kyky yhdistää haarat tehokkaasti. Kun olet työntänyt paikallisen haarasi etävarastoon ja tehnyt siitä seurattavan, saatat joutua yhdistämään muutokset muista haaroista. Tämä voidaan tehdä käyttämällä komento, joka integroi muutokset haarasta toiseen. Haarojen ajantasaisuuden ja ristiriitojen ratkaisemisen varmistaminen on erittäin tärkeää koodin eheyden ylläpitämiseksi.

Lisäksi on hyödyllistä puhdistaa vanhentuneet oksat säännöllisesti. Tämä voidaan saavuttaa käyttämällä komento poistaa paikalliset haarat, joita ei enää tarvita, ja poistaaksesi etähaarat. Asianmukainen sivukonttorin hallinta parantaa yhteistyötä ja pitää arkiston järjestyksessä, mikä helpottaa ryhmien työskentelyä useiden ominaisuuksien ja korjausten parissa samanaikaisesti.

  1. Kuinka nimeän paikallisen sivukonttorin uudelleen?
  2. Voit nimetä paikallisen haarakontin uudelleen komennolla .
  3. Kuinka voin luetella kaikki arkistossani olevat haarat?
  4. Käytä komentoa luettelemaan kaikki paikalliset ja etähaarat.
  5. Mikä on komento paikallisen haaran poistamiseksi?
  6. Jos haluat poistaa paikallisen haaran, käytä .
  7. Miten vaihdan toiseen toimipisteeseen?
  8. Vaihda toiseen haaraan käyttämällä .
  9. Kuinka voin tarkistaa sivukonttorieni seurantatilan?
  10. Käytä komentoa nähdäksesi seurantatiedot.
  11. Mikä on komento poistaa etähaara?
  12. Jos haluat poistaa etähaaran, käytä .
  13. Kuinka yhdistän haaran nykyiseen haaraan?
  14. Yhdistä toinen haara nykyiseen käyttämällä .
  15. Kuinka voin ratkaista yhdistämisristiriidat?
  16. Ratkaise yhdistämisristiriidat manuaalisesti muokkaamalla ristiriitaisia ​​tiedostoja ja käyttämällä sitten merkitä ne ratkaistuiksi.
  17. Miten haen ja integroin muutokset etävarastosta?
  18. Käyttää noutaaksesi ja integroidaksesi muutokset etävarastosta.

Git Branch -työnkulun päättäminen

Haarojen tehokas hallinta Gitissä on ratkaisevan tärkeää puhtaan ja järjestäytyneen koodikannan ylläpitämiseksi. Luomalla, työntämällä ja seuraamalla haaroja kehittäjät voivat työskennellä useiden ominaisuuksien ja virheenkorjausten parissa samanaikaisesti ilman ristiriitoja. Käyttämällä komentoja, kuten ja , sekä haaran seurannan tarkistaminen, virtaviivaistaa näitä prosesseja. Näiden vaiheiden automatisointi komentosarjoilla parantaa entisestään tehokkuutta ja vähentää virheitä.

Asianmukaisella sivukonttorin hallinnalla tiimit voivat tehdä yhteistyötä tehokkaammin ja varmistaa, että kaikki käyttävät uusinta koodia. Vanhojen oksien säännöllinen puhdistaminen ja muutosten nopea yhdistäminen auttavat pitämään arkiston siistinä ja ajan tasalla. Näiden Git-tekniikoiden hallitseminen on välttämätöntä kaikille kehittäjille, jotka haluavat parantaa työnkulkuaan ja yhteistyötään.

Git-haaroittamisen ja -seurannan hallitseminen on välttämätöntä tehokkaan yhteistyön ja versionhallinnan kannalta. Noudattamalla kuvattuja vaiheita ja käyttämällä automaatiokomentosarjoja kehittäjät voivat virtaviivaistaa työnkulkuaan, vähentää virheitä ja ylläpitää puhdasta koodikantaa. Asianmukainen toimipisteen hallinta varmistaa, että kaikki tiimin jäsenet voivat helposti pysyä ajan tasalla ja työskennellä tehokkaasti projektin eri osissa.